The Story: In 2015, audiences were introduced to When Calls The Heart: New Year's Wish. Taking place within the realm of Drama, History, Romance, the story highlights A fresh start for Jack and Elizabeth, a surprise guest for Abigail, an adventure for Rosemary and Lee, an unwanted visitor from Pastor Hogan's past, and new beginnings for the town makes this the most unforgettable New Year's celebration Hope Valley has ever seen.
